Busch driver Grubb refuses drug test, is suspended again

NASCAR announced Tuesday that it has suspended Busch series driver Kevin Grubb indefinitely for refusing to take a drug test. This is the second time Grubb has violated NASCAR's substance-abuse policy.

NASCAR spokesman Jim Hunter told The Associated Press that Grubb, 28, refused to submit to a random drug test - which was part of Grubb's agreement for reinstatement June7 - after Friday's race at Richmond , during which Grubb crashed on the first lap.
